Applied Combinatorics is an open-source textbook for a course covering the fundamental enumeration techniques (permutations, combinations, subsets, pigeon hole principle), recursion and mathematical induction, more advanced enumeration techniques (inclusion-exclusion, generating functions, recurrence relations, Polyá theory), discrete structures (graphs, digraphs, posets, interval orders), and discrete optimization (minimum weight spanning trees, shortest paths, network flows). There are also chapters introducing discrete probability, Ramsey theory, combinatorial applications of network flows, and a few other nuggets of discrete mathematics.
Applied Combinatorics began its life as a set of course notes we developed when Mitch was a TA for a larger than usual section of Tom’s MATH 3012: Applied Combinatorics course at Georgia Tech in Spring Semester 2006. Since then, the material has been greatly expanded and exercises have been added. The text has been in use for most MATH 3012 sections at Georgia Tech for several years now. Since the text has been available online for free, it has also been adopted at a number of other institutions for a wide variety of courses. In August 2016, we made the first release of Applied Combinatorics in HTML format, thanks to a conversion of the book’s source from LaTeX to MathBook XML. An inexpensive print-on-demand version is also available for purchase. Find out all about ways to get the book.

Since Fall 2016, Applied Combinatorics has been on the list of approved open textbooks from the American Institute of Mathematics.

This textbook provides a toolbox, a guidebook, and an instruction manual for researchers and interventionists who want to conceptualize and study applied problems from a developmental systems perspective, and for those who want to teach their graduate (or advanced undergraduate) students how to do this. It is designed to be useful to practitioners who focus on applied developmental problems, such as improving the important developmental contexts where people live, learn, and work, including the applied professions in education, social work, counseling, health care, community development, and business, all of which at their core are concerned with optimizing the development of their students, clients, patients, workers, citizens, and others whose lives they touch.

This lab manual provides students with the theory, practical applications, objectives, and laboratory procedure of ten experiments. The manual also includes educational videos showing how student should run each experiment and a workbook for organizing data collected in the lab and preparing result tables and charts.

Long Description:
Basic engineering knowledge about fluid mechanics is required in various sectors of water resources engineering, such as designing hydraulic structure on any riverine environments and flood mitigation process. The objective of this book is to enable students to understand fundamental concepts in the field of fluid mechanics and apply those concepts in practice. Applied Fluid Mechanics Lab Manual is designed to enhance civil engineering students’ understanding and knowledge of experimental methods and basic principles of fluid mechanics. The ten experiments in this lab manual provide an overview of widely used terms and phenomena of fluid mechanics and open channel flow, which are required for solving engineering problems.

Marx, en 1884, define el término trabajo cooperativo como “múltiples individuos trabajando juntos de una manera planificada en un mismo proceso de producción o en procesos de producción diferentes pero conectados” [MAR84]. Por otro lado, se afirma que un trabajo cooperativo “está formado por procesos de trabajo relacionados. Cada proceso genera ciertas tareas a ser desarrolladas por los miembros del equipo de trabajo para el cumplimiento de los objetivos” [COR04]. Bannon y Schmidt establecen que hay muchas formas de trabajo cooperativo, por ejemplo: trabajo colaborativo, trabajo colectivo, trabajo coordinado, y trabajo de articulación [BAN89a].

In this lesson, students in this lesson will learn about, connect, and apply the use of the area to a real-world problem—creating a planting guide for the garden. Students will determine the square footage of the garden and use this information, along with a planting chart to create their own plan. Background for instructors:Math in the REAL world: Area and square feetSquare foot gardening is one way that ensures a vegetable garden bed can thrive. It is used to ensure not too many plants of a specific variety are planted in a single area. Using the square foot model keeps plants properly spaced, providing a perfect real-world context to teach area, apply multiplication strategies, and have students work collaboratively. Most garden beds are 8 x 4 resulting in 32 square feet to work with. It is possible however to have beds of different sizes. While 32 square feet to work with is what is used in this lesson, the methods and chart can be used for any rectangular planting area.

Arguments in Context is a comprehensive introduction to critical thinking that covers all the basics in student-friendly language. Intended for use in a semester-long course, the text features classroom-tested examples and exercises that have been chosen to emphasize the relevance and applicability of the subject to everyday life. Three themes are developed as the text proceeds from argument identification and analysis, to the standards and techniques of evaluation: (i) the importance of asking the right questions, (ii) the influence of biases, cognitive illusions, and other psychological factors, and (iii) the ways that social situations and structures can enhance and impoverish our thinking. On this last point, the text includes sustained discussion of disagreement, cooperative dialogue, testimony, trust, and social media. Overall, the text aims to equip readers with a set of tools for working through important decisions and disagreements, and to help them become more careful and active thinkers.

Students learn more about how muscles work and how biomedical engineers can help keep the muscular system healthy. Following the engineering design process, they create their own biomedical device to aid in the recovery of a strained bicep. They discover the importance of rest to muscle recovery and that muscles (just like engineers!) work together to achieve a common goal.

Courses on Artificial Intelligence (AI) and Librarianship in ALA-accredited Masters of Library and Information (MLIS) degrees are rare. We have all been surprised by ChatGPT and similar Large Language Models. Generative AI is an important new area for librarianship. It is also developing so rapidly that no one can really keep up. Those trying to produce AI courses for the MLIS degree need all the help they can get. This book is a gesture of support. It consists of about 95,000 words on the topic, with a 3-400 item bibliography.
